Bio Notes: The Edinburgh practice of Ross-Smith & Jamieson worked in conjunction with Brown Lloyd & Partners of Newcastle in the 1960s and 1970s. No further details are yet known.

Ross-Smith & Jamieson received a Civic Trust Commendation for housing in Edinburgh in 1969. it is possible that this is Carnegie Court.
